For the Master’s Program, we have reorganized the graduate school to make it “easy to enter and easy to learn.” First, we hold entrance examinations twice a year, in September and February, for both the general admission and the entrance examination for working adults. In addition, we have established an exemption system for the written foreign language exam component of the general entrance examination, and have abolished the written foreign language exam component for the entrance examination for working adults. Furthermore, since the 2021 entrance examination, we have introduced an examination system that requires only a document review (including a research plan) and an oral examination. After admission, students can complete the Master’s course in one year if they meet certain requirements, and can obtain a degree by submitting a master’s thesis or research paper.
The main objective of the Doctoral Program is to train researchers. Many graduates of this program are employed as university faculty members.
Curriculum
The Master’s Program aims to deepen the basic knowledge of the law and political science generally acquired at the undergraduate level, to help students transition to research in their major, and to cultivate advanced legal and analytical skills in politics. For working people, there are specialized courses that relate the knowledge and experience acquired in the working world to the major courses and aim to sharpen specialized perspectives and analytical skills.
To meet the diverse needs of students, including not only aspiring researchers but also highly specialized professionals and those who wish to become such, the Master’s Program curriculum allows students to take social science-related courses and practical courses in ten other departments.
